Madison County, Montana's estimated 2024 population is 9,790 with a growth rate of 2.83% in the past year according to the most recent United States census data. Madison County, Montana is the 24th largest county in Montana. The 2010 population was 7,696 and has seen a growth of 27.21% since that time.

95.71% of Madison County, Montana residents speak only English, while 4.29% speak other languages. The non-English language spoken by the largest group is Spanish, which is spoken by 3.3% of the population.

Poverty in Madison County, Montana

The race most likely to be in poverty in Madison County, Montana is Native, with 43.59% below the poverty level.

The race least likely to be in poverty in Madison County, Montana is Other, with 4.76% below the poverty level.

The poverty rate among those that worked full-time for the past 12 months was 2.2%. Among those working part-time, it was 5.56%, and for those that did not work, the poverty rate was 10.53%.

97.19% of Madison County, Montana residents were born in the United States, with 37.98% having been born in Montana. 1.1% of residents are not US citizens. Of those not born in the United States, the largest percentage are from Europe.
